  3. MENEMSHA FILMS. Directed by Jérôme Cohen-Olivar. Starring Gad Elmaleh. Morroco. Released: 2016. Arabic, English, French. 102 minutes. After leaving Morocco as a child amidst racial tensions spurred by the Yom Kippur War, the son of a once famous Jewish musician returns to his home country to bury his father.
